  10. So we just recently got back from the Mardi Gras. If you have the hub app, you can easily check the schedule for the kids club daily and what activities they’ll have. They had open play, crafts, games, theme nights, pajamas parties etc. We registered our children at cruise check in and that’s where we also gave permission to who could pick them up and sign them in. Also if they could sign themselves out (age depending). Then on embarkation day we went down and they had the facility open for parents to tour and kids to check out. You could also register then if you hadn’t yet. Our 4 year old twins had an absolute blast!

  18. Although we didn’t cruise out of Galveston, we just did a cruise in a suite. When you arrive to port there’s the priority line, early/late line and the on time line. Make sure you go to the priority line and they’ll also sit you in the priority lounge. Just make sure you listen to announcements at the port. They’ll announce diamonds and then suites, then platinums and FTTF.
